Introduction to the Panel 1200×600
The panel 1200×600 refers to a display screen with a resolution of 1200 pixels in width and 600 pixels in height. This aspect ratio is commonly used in a variety of applications, including digital signage, medical imaging, and industrial control systems. The size and resolution of the panel make it versatile and suitable for different display needs.
Technical Specifications
The technical specifications of a 1200×600 panel can vary depending on the manufacturer and intended use. However, some common features include:
– Resolution: 1200×600 pixels
– Aspect Ratio: 2:1
– Color Depth: Typically 24-bit (16.7 million colors)
– Contrast Ratio: Varies, but usually between 500:1 and 1000:1
– Viewing Angle: Typically 160 degrees horizontal and 160 degrees vertical
– Response Time: Depends on the technology used, with TN panels offering faster response times than IPS or VA panels
Applications of the Panel 1200×600
The 1200×600 panel is widely used in several industries due to its compact size and high resolution. Here are some of the key applications:
– Digital Signage: These panels are commonly used in outdoor and indoor digital signage solutions, such as billboards, kiosks, and menu boards in restaurants and cafes.
– Medical Imaging: The high resolution and color accuracy make them suitable for medical imaging applications, such as displaying X-ray images and MRI scans.
– Industrial Control: They are used in industrial control systems for monitoring and displaying data, as well as in machine vision applications.
– Education: These panels can be found in educational institutions for interactive whiteboards and projectors.
– Home Entertainment: While not as common as larger screens, the 1200×600 panel can be used for home entertainment systems, such as digital picture frames and small video displays.
